Answer:
The equation of the line is y = 1/4x - 4
Step-by-step explanation:
In order to find this, start with two points that are on the line. We'll use (0, -4) and (4, -3). Now we can use the slope formula to find the slope.
m(slope) = (y2 - y1)/(x2 - x1)
m = (-4 - -3)/(0 - 4)
m = -1/-4
m = 1/4
Now that we have this, we can use that slope and a point in point-slope form. Then we solve for y to get the equation.
y - y1 = m(x - x1)
y - -4 = 1/4(x - 0)
y + 4 = 1/4x
y = 1/4x - 4
